About

Tega Cay Gourmet Deli offers a relaxed waterfront dining experience perfect for families looking to enjoy a casual meal with stunning Lake Wylie views. With a dedicated kids menu, outdoor seating options, and a laid-back deli atmosphere, it's an ideal spot for breakfast or brunch after morning activities or a low-key lunch where kids can enjoy bagels, sandwiches, and other American favorites without the pressure of formal dining.

Pro Tips

  1. 1.Request outdoor seating for the best lake views,kids can watch boats on Lake Wylie while they eat, making mealtime more entertaining
  2. 2.Visit during weekday mornings to avoid weekend breakfast crowds and snag the best waterfront tables
  3. 3.The bagels are a hit with picky eaters, so consider ordering a variety for sharing if your kids are hesitant about trying new foods
  4. 4.Bring stale bread to feed the ducks near the water after your meal (check local regulations first)
  5. 5.Take advantage of the casual counter-service style if you have impatient little ones,faster than traditional table service

Best Time to Visit

Weekday mornings between 8-10 AM offer the most relaxed atmosphere with shorter waits and easier access to outdoor tables. Weekend brunch is popular but expect busier crowds; arriving right when they open gives you first pick of lakeside seating.

What to Know

This is a budget-friendly option with counter service and a casual vibe, so parents can relax without worrying about kids being too loud. Outdoor seating is weather-dependent, and the location in Stonecrest shopping area offers easy parking.

Seasonal Notes

Spring and fall offer the most comfortable outdoor dining weather with pleasant temperatures and beautiful lake views. Summer mornings are lovely but can get hot by midday, while winter outdoor seating may be limited. The deli operates year-round for indoor dining.
